Xbox Game Pass Leak Points to Capped Cloud Gaming Tiers

Xbox Game Pass Leak Points to Capped Cloud Gaming Tiers

Leaked Duet and Triton tiers suggest Microsoft may test lower-cost Xbox Game Pass plans with capped cloud gaming access.

Microsoft may be exploring new Xbox Game Pass plans that introduce monthly limits for cloud gaming, according to a recent datamine from @redphx on X. The reported tiers, Duet and Triton, remain unconfirmed, with Microsoft yet to announce timing, pricing, final details, or whether the plans exist at all.

According to the leak, both subscriptions could support Xbox Cloud Gaming through a fixed monthly time allowance rather than unlimited streaming. If launched, that would mark a change from Microsoft’s current cloud-enabled Game Pass structure, which has promoted unrestricted access across supported plans.

Triton is stated to be a first-party-focused tier built around Microsoft-owned franchises.  

Meanwhile, references tied the plan to titles such as Fallout, Doom, Fable, Halo, Gears, Hellblade, Ori, State of Decay, Psychonauts, and The Elder Scrolls Online. Redphx also added on a previous thread that “Games in the TRITON program will be included in the DUET subscription.”

Xbox Game Pass Triton and Duet May Target Lower-Cost Users

Duet has separately been linked to a possible Netflix bundle, though no partnership has been announced. If accurate, the plan could combine selected Xbox content with a streaming subscription in an effort to broaden Game Pass appeal.

The leak arrives amid ongoing discussion around Game Pass pricing. In a memo obtained by The Verge, EVP and CEO of Xbox, Asha Sharma, reportedly said the service had “become too expensive for players” and that the existing model is not absolute.

Any capped cloud tier would resemble NVIDIA’s GeForce NOW system. NVIDIA introduced a 100-hour monthly allowance for paid members, with additional hours sold separately.

Still, the backend references suggest Microsoft is reviewing lower-cost Game Pass options while managing cloud demand and subscription pressure.
